On Fri, Jul 30, 2021 at 04:49:52PM +0800, Chunfeng Yun wrote:
Add property 'tpl-support' to support targeted peripheral list
for USB-IF Embedded Host Compliance Test
Given you have to configure the TPL somehow, how is this useful to be in 
DT? And no, that's not a suggestion to put all the TPL config into DT.
